From Isaac Job, Uyo
The Federal Government has urged religious to champion interfaith harmony and shun violence while working assiduously to reconcile warring communities divided by conflict.
In a statement from office of the secretary to Government of the Federation (SGF) Senator George Akume signed by the Special Adviser Media And Publicity Yemi Odunuga and made available to Journalists in Uyo after the opening ceremony of the Second Plenary Meeting of the Catholic Bishops Conference of Nigeria (CBCN) in Ikot Ekpene , the President stated that the religious leader are capable of galvanizing all interests to national unity and development.
Tinubu who was represented by Akume said the role of religious leaders in shaping values and building trust among citizens cannot be overemphasised adding that faith-based organisations remain a vital bridge for peace, unity, and moral renewal in the country.
He commended the Catholic Bishops and other clerics across denominations for their consistent efforts in promoting dialogue and tolerance despite Nigeria’s diversity.
According to him, genuine reconciliation and national cohesion can only be achieved when spiritual leaders continue to preach messages of peace and actively discourage extremism, hatred, and divisive tendencies.

He said Tinubu assured the clerics that his administration tackle root causes of insecurity and social unrest, including poverty, unemployment, and inequality.
He urged religious leaders to complement government efforts by providing guidance to their followers, nurturing communities with values of honesty, hard work, and compassion.
“The Catholic Church has been a credible partner in the journey towards national renewal,” the President said.
“Your investments in education, health and socal welfare – often in remote and underserved communities – speak louder than words. You have stood with the people in times of hardship, provided comfort in times of grief and raised your voice against injustice and corruption.
“I encourage you to continue speaking truth to power not only to government but to all sectors of society – while also offering constructive solutions that will help us collectively build a nation where integrity, hard work and compassion are the hallmarks of public and private life”.
